Getting Started with Sonic Bloom
Welcome to Sonic Bloom! This guide will help you create your first musician website in under 10 minutes.
What You'll Need
- An email address
- Your music files (MP3, WAV, FLAC, or M4A)
- Photos of yourself or your band
- Basic information about your music
Step 1: Create Your Account
- Go to gosonicbloom.com
- Click "Sign Up"
- Enter your email and create a password
- Verify your email address
Cost: Start with a 30-day free trial (no credit card required).
Step 2: Choose Your Artist Name
Your artist name becomes your website URL:
- Example: If you choose "johndoe", your site will be johndoe.gosonicbloom.com
- You can add a custom domain later (like johndoe.com)
Tips:
- Use lowercase letters and hyphens only
- Keep it short and memorable
- Match your existing artist name
Step 3: Pick a Theme
Choose a theme that matches your music style:
- Classic: Traditional musician layout (folk, country, rock)
- Indie Artist: Warm, organic design (indie, folk)
- Electronic Producer: Dark mode with visualizations (electronic, EDM)
- Band: Group-focused with member profiles (bands, ensembles)
- Hip-Hop: Bold typography and high contrast (hip-hop, rap)
Don't worry - you can change your theme anytime!
Step 4: Upload Your Music
- Go to Dashboard โ Music
- Click "Upload Track"
- Select your audio file (up to 50MB per track)
- Add track details:
- Title
- Description
- Release date (optional)
- Click "Save"
Supported Formats: MP3, WAV, FLAC, M4A
Step 5: Add Your Bio and Photos
- Go to Dashboard โ Profile
- Fill in your bio:
- Artist name
- Hometown
- Bio (tell your story!)
- Upload a profile photo
- Upload a header/banner image
Image Requirements:
- Profile photo: Square (recommended 400x400px)
- Header image: Landscape (recommended 1920x600px)
- Formats: JPG, PNG, GIF

Common Questions
Can I change my subdomain later?
Yes! Go to Dashboard โ Settings โ Change Subdomain. Your old subdomain will redirect automatically.
How do I add a custom domain?
Custom domains are included in both paid plans! Go to Dashboard โ Domain and follow the DNS setup instructions. SSL certificates are provisioned automatically.
Can I upload videos?
Not yet, but you can embed YouTube or Vimeo videos in your bio or show descriptions.
How do I delete my account?
Go to Dashboard โ Settings โ Delete Account. Your data will be permanently removed within 30 days.
Can I export my data?
Yes! Go to Dashboard โ Settings โ Export Data. You'll receive a ZIP file with all your music, photos, and fan emails.
